About Claudio Arbib

Claudio Arbib is a scholar working on Industrial and Manufacturing Engineering, Computer Networks and Communications, Computational Theory and Mathematics, Ocean Engineering and Management Science and Operations Research, having authored 51 papers that have together received 516 indexed citations. Recurring topics across this work include Scheduling and Optimization Algorithms (20 papers), Optimization and Packing Problems (19 papers), Advanced Manufacturing and Logistics Optimization (16 papers), Manufacturing Process and Optimization (11 papers), Assembly Line Balancing Optimization (8 papers), Optimization and Search Problems (5 papers), Vehicle Routing Optimization Methods (5 papers) and Evacuation and Crowd Dynamics (4 papers). The work is most often cited by research in Industrial and Manufacturing Engineering (379 citations), Computer Graphics and Computer-Aided Design (37 citations), Management Information Systems (40 citations), Discrete Mathematics and Combinatorics (11 citations) and Computer Networks and Communications (69 citations). Claudio Arbib has collaborated with scholars based in Italy, Türkiye and United States. Frequent co-authors include Fabrizio Marinelli, Fabrizio Rossi, Stefano Smriglio, Alessandro Agnetis, Dario Pacciarelli, Paolo Ventura, F. Nicolò, Raffaele Mosca, Francesco Iorio and Mustafa Ç. Pı̆nar. Their work appears in journals such as European Journal of Operational Research, Networks, Discrete Applied Mathematics, Computers & Operations Research and Omega.
